Gucci Store Manager position in Cape Town, South Africa. Lead retail operations, drive sales, and manage a high-performing team in this luxury retail leadership role.
Role & Responsibilities
- Drive and maximize sales performance to consistently achieve overall sales budget objectives while ensuring operational integrity and monitoring monthly profitability
- Demonstrate sales leadership through active floor presence and customer engagement, with personal focus on top-tier clients and achieving annual mystery shop goals
- Manage and communicate with key business departments to optimize stock levels, maximize full-price selling, and align with new product launches
- Train and educate all associates on current collection knowledge, brand pillars, and seasonal strategy through partnerships with internal departments
- Communicate company KPIs and develop strategies to ensure performance standards are consistently met
- Develop and implement business action plans to enhance sales across product categories and client segments
- Lead the team in establishing client relationships, organizing local events, and supporting product launches to drive attendance and sales results
- Conduct monthly coaching and performance review sessions with associates; oversee annual review process and set employee development goals
- Attract, recruit, and retain high-performing team members; build talent pipeline through networking and competitive analysis
- Ensure consistent, branded onboarding experiences for all new hires and manage staff allocation and scheduling
- Manage client retention and development through top-client strategies and personalized engagement
- Utilize CRM initiatives to capture meaningful customer data and drive personalized client development opportunities
- Monitor monthly store performance and expense management; maintain operating budget while reducing overall costs
- Comply with loss prevention protocols, cycle counts, incident reporting, and inventory reconciliations to maintain shrinkage below company targets
- Maintain visual merchandising standards and ensure full organization of company assets per headquarters guidelines
- Proactively monitor fashion trends, industry developments, and competitor activities in the marketplace
Qualifications
- Minimum 4 years of sales management experience in retail, luxury retail, or service-related industry
- Bachelor's Degree in a related field (preferred)
- Advanced English proficiency
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office software (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ook)
- Proven ability to analyze selling reports and identify business trends
- Strong verbal and written communication skills and excellent organizational abilities
- Demonstrated track record of driving positive customer experiences that build loyalty and deliver measurable results
